Relational representation for subordination Tarski algebras

ABSTRACT

In this work, we study the relational representation of the class of Tarski algebras endowed with a subordination, called subordination Tarski algebras. These structures were introduced in a previous paper as a generalisation of subordination Boolean algebras. We define the subordination Tarski spaces as topological spaces with a fixed basis endowed with a closed relation. We prove that there exist categorical dualities between categories whose objects are subordination Tarski algebras and categories whose objects are subordination Tarski spaces. These results extend the known dualities for modal algebras. Finally, we are going to characterise some algebraic conditions written in the quasi-modal language by means of first-order conditions.
